Each league is split into skill divisions, so you are playing against people at roughly your level. Which leagues run in a season, and which divisions each one carries, changes season to season. The season page always says what is actually on offer.
Our most social division. There are no pre-made teams here. Everyone signs up on their own and we place them, so rosters are built fresh every season. It's where new players find their feet, and where plenty of seasoned players land too when they'd rather enjoy the game than grind it.
Best forAnyone who's here for the social side of it. New players learning the game, and veterans who want to have fun with it.
The middle rung, and where most of our players land. Depending on the season you can register on your own or bring a roster, and often both. You know the game and you want real competition, without it turning into a full-time commitment.
Best forPlayers with a season or two behind them who want a genuine challenge, with or without a roster.
Our top division, and the one place you do need a team. Premier squads come in already rostered and ready for the level. Higher intensity, tighter games, and everyone shows up prepared. This is where the most experienced players in the community test themselves against each other.
Best forExperienced, competitive players chasing the highest level we run. Bring a full team that can hold its own. Signing up on your own? Recreational and Intermediate both have a spot for you.
You don't need a team to play. In Recreational, everyone signs up on their own and we place them, so rosters are built fresh every season. Intermediate takes both: sign up alone and we'll find you a squad, or bring one you've already got. Premier is the exception. It's our top level and teams come in already rostered, so you'll need a full team for that one. Not sure which division fits? Pick the one that sounds right and tell us at registration. We'd rather move you than have you sit in the wrong division all season.

Minnesota Dodgeball provides opportunities for players to participate in recreational and competitive dodgeball throughout the state. We're not just a league. We're a space where people connect, compete, and genuinely belong.
Radical inclusion. LGBTQ+-affirming, WTNB-centered leagues, and a community where you never have to explain or defend who you are.
Accessible play. Financial assistance is available. Everyone who wants to play should be able to play.
Year-round fun. 7-9 week seasons with 2-3 weeks off between each, all year. Plus open gyms, tournaments, and community events.
